Stuart Breckenridge
dee9461057
Wraps and Restores TickMarkSlider
2022-12-21 13:31:21 +08:00
Stuart Breckenridge
31768eb274
Fixes ArticleTheme Import on SwiftUI
...
Adds startAccessingSecurityScopedResource and stopAccessingSecurityScopedResource to `.fileImporter`s.
2022-12-21 12:31:54 +08:00
Stuart Breckenridge
1a1f86febd
Changes
...
Extensions now use sheet
Feedbin case added so that feedbin shows
2022-12-21 10:53:43 +08:00
Stuart Breckenridge
199b9e4093
Removes logging call
2022-12-20 23:13:38 +08:00
Stuart Breckenridge
fe5a7d185b
Tidy up on the themes view
2022-12-20 22:04:04 +08:00
Stuart Breckenridge
53e49aa699
Article themes moved to SwiftUI
2022-12-20 20:35:18 +08:00
Stuart Breckenridge
432aeea1b5
Localises IconImage descriptions
...
- Deletes UIKit Timeline customizer
2022-12-20 17:26:19 +08:00
Stuart Breckenridge
686d93f49e
Switched to Pickers instead of Sliders
...
…because tick marks on SwiftUI pickers are painful
2022-12-20 17:20:45 +08:00
Stuart Breckenridge
7a41b411c8
WIP on Timeline Customiser
2022-12-20 09:03:42 +08:00
Stuart Breckenridge
eedc191b7e
Restore extension and account restrictions
2022-12-19 12:17:06 +08:00
Stuart Breckenridge
ef6b90d594
Enabling Extensions now possible in SwiftUI
2022-12-19 12:14:56 +08:00
Stuart Breckenridge
dbef68c8f8
Pretend to delete accounts to match animations
2022-12-18 22:12:00 +08:00
Stuart Breckenridge
32099af19f
Translations
2022-12-18 21:37:11 +08:00
Stuart Breckenridge
a982dc564d
Adds done button to settings
2022-12-18 21:20:00 +08:00
Stuart Breckenridge
cfb26c909b
Add .textContentType to enable autofill
2022-12-18 19:20:52 +08:00
Stuart Breckenridge
28e7a2324e
Tidy up
...
- Give AccountManagement a ViewModel
- Hides footer explainers when it’s not a new account creation
2022-12-18 18:33:37 +08:00
Stuart Breckenridge
cbd78a2cf4
transition not required
2022-12-18 17:08:48 +08:00
Stuart Breckenridge
b4cb253c66
Spit and polish on the Accounts views
2022-12-18 17:08:03 +08:00
Stuart Breckenridge
4ed11c0fc6
AddAccount sheets done
2022-12-18 15:51:42 +08:00
Stuart Breckenridge
8108f1ab0f
Adds local add account view
...
Renames AddAccount view for clarity
2022-12-18 07:51:54 +08:00
Stuart Breckenridge
4ff0bc8f98
Reader and CloudKit Account Views
2022-12-16 16:38:06 +08:00
Stuart Breckenridge
b3208bf269
Removes deadcode
2022-12-15 22:06:05 +08:00
Stuart Breckenridge
50964bf32b
Removeds AddAccountViewController
2022-12-15 22:05:28 +08:00
Stuart Breckenridge
b526f05e68
All iOS Inspectors are now SwiftUI
2022-12-15 21:12:37 +08:00
Stuart Breckenridge
f42b6e5473
This commit includes:
...
- Localisation for new SwiftUI Settings Views
- Inactive/Active Account sections in the Manage Account View
- Early work to deprecate AddAccountViewController
2022-12-15 09:30:28 +08:00
Stuart Breckenridge
369c346139
Changes
...
- Removes unused classes
- Posts a notification when the app is opened via external context which allows the SwiftUI SettingsView to dismiss itself.
2022-12-14 07:15:22 +08:00
Stuart Breckenridge
30e5b5485d
Removes print
2022-12-13 13:35:59 +08:00
Stuart Breckenridge
766e092d21
NewArticleNotificationsView Changes
...
WebFeed is an ObservableObject, which allows the Notifications View to update favicons based on the feed.
2022-12-13 13:32:57 +08:00
Stuart Breckenridge
9a0a79619a
actual fix for wrapping
2022-12-13 11:45:31 +08:00
Stuart Breckenridge
a48ae73dda
NewArticleNotifications
...
- Fixes wrapping
- Reloads on Favicon availability
2022-12-13 11:37:51 +08:00
Stuart Breckenridge
d1a7d0fbc7
slightly bigger icons
2022-12-13 11:17:18 +08:00
Stuart Breckenridge
00a148cd71
Improves UI for swipe to remove accounts
2022-12-13 09:43:34 +08:00
Stuart Breckenridge
ad66d7072c
Multiple revisions
...
Accounts
- Manage Accounts title updated to “Manage Accounts”
- Swift left to delete account added (with confirmation alert)
- After adding an account, user is returned to the Manage Accounts view
- Done button added to the Add Account view
Extensions
- Plus button added
- Consistent UI with Add Account
- Swipe left to deactivate added (with confirmation alert)
Import / Export
- Converted to two separate cells, with action sheet
2022-12-13 09:14:03 +08:00
Stuart Breckenridge
07d9c3dd08
camelCase SettingsViewRows
2022-12-13 07:08:45 +08:00
Stuart Breckenridge
a9b0d05c83
Restores correct Extension Points in dev builds
2022-12-05 06:48:36 +08:00
Stuart Breckenridge
662556ad68
navigationStyle modifier move to correct place
2022-12-05 06:27:57 +08:00
Stuart Breckenridge
714e00f616
Merge branch 'main' into ios-ui-settings
...
# Conflicts:
# iOS/AppDefaults.swift
2022-12-04 21:10:17 +08:00
Stuart Breckenridge
d6284f6b6c
Settings Additions
...
- Timeline Layout
- Programmatic navigation to Mark All as Read
2022-12-04 21:01:32 +08:00
Maurice Parker
f3bb949374
Remove dead code (was for multiplatform target)
2022-12-03 12:51:37 -06:00
Maurice Parker
209d4483c6
Guard against negative numbers. Fixes #3768
2022-12-02 20:53:10 -06:00
Maurice Parker
1c4b0c486a
Don't show limitations and solutions view on non-iCloud accounts. Fixes #3765 .
2022-12-02 20:16:52 -06:00
Stuart Breckenridge
f2cda7fcad
More settings work
2022-11-30 21:37:39 +08:00
Stuart Breckenridge
36fa87b8c4
More Options Added to Settings
2022-11-29 19:12:44 +08:00
Maurice Parker
c3ddf2b46c
Update the UI in the correct order. Fixes #3761 .
2022-11-28 20:01:12 -06:00
Maurice Parker
7c9ac3d712
Add the concept of direct vs. indirect marking of articles. Fixes #3734
2022-11-14 21:10:16 -06:00
Maurice Parker
02e19366fb
Removed the entity names from the Mark All items to match the Mac app
2022-11-14 20:18:09 -06:00
Stuart Breckenridge
08d46f877b
minor tweaks
2022-11-14 19:36:58 +08:00
Maurice Parker
97d139d5ae
Merge branch 'mac-release1'
2022-11-13 19:43:51 -06:00
Maurice Parker
f6feb64289
Merge branch 'ios-candidate'
2022-11-13 19:36:32 -06:00
Maurice Parker
fcee0a605b
Merge branch 'ios-release'
2022-11-13 19:26:53 -06:00